Jessica Biel joins ‘A Team’

Recently reported by Empire Magazine, Jessica Biel will be taking on the role of ex-girlfriend to Bradley Cooper’s “Faceman” Pecks, which semi-completes the A-Team line up. The other confirmed members of the cast are Liam Neeson as ‘Hannibal’ and Quinton “Rampage” Jackson as ‘BA Baracus’ . Disney acquires Marvel

You’ve certainly heard of smaller businesses being acquired and consumed by larger, more profitable businesses but Marvel is no small business. It has been confirmed that the comic book giant has just been acquired by Disney for $4 billion USD. That’s a whole heap of comic books, son!
